For years, people assumed emotions came only from the brain.

But scientists now know that the gut and brain are in constant communication through a network known as the gut-brain axis.

This is a two-way communication system involving nerves, hormones, immune signals, and perhaps most surprisingly, trillions of bacteria living inside our intestines.

Yes, the tiny microbes in your gut may be influencing far more than your digestion.

Those helpful roommates

Your intestines are home to trillions of bacteria and other microorganisms, which are collectively known as the gut microbiome.

While this may sound alarming, most of these microbes are actually helpful roommates.

They help digest food, produce vitamins, regulate inflammation, support immunity and communicate with the nervous system.

In return, all they ask for is some fibre and decent treatment.

Unfortunately, many of us are feeding ourselves while quietly starving our microbes.

Modern lifestyles are not exactly microbial paradise.

Fast food, ultra-processed snacks, sugary drinks, irregular meals, chronic stress and poor sleep are becoming increasingly common, especially among busy Malaysians juggling work, traffic, deadlines and social media-fuelled stress.

Our gut bacteria are probably stressed and exhausted too.

Our ‘second brain’

Scientists sometimes refer to the gut as the “second brain”.

This is not because there is an actual brain in the abdomen, but because the digestive system contains an enormous network of nerves known as the enteric nervous system.

This network constantly exchanges signals with the brain.

In fact, up to 90% of the body’s serotonin – a chemical involved in mood regulation – is produced in the gut.

This does not mean that your stomach has feelings or your bacteria are secretly controlling your life choices.

Your microbes are probably not responsible for that midnight online shopping spree or your decision to drink a fourth cup of coffee at 10pm.

However, growing research suggests that gut microbes may influence how the body responds to stress, inflammation and emotional regulation.

Research published in the journal Nature Reviews Microbiology in 2023 highlighted how gut microbes communicate with the brain through chemical, immune and nerve pathways.

Another study published in the journal Nature Mental Health in 2024 found associations between certain gut microbiome patterns and depressive symptoms.

Scientists are still learning exactly how strong these connections are, but the evidence supporting the gut–brain axis continues to grow rapidly.

Stress and your gut

Stress itself can disrupt the gut microbiome, creating a biological loop.

Stress changes the gut environment, and an unhealthy gut may in turn worsen stress responses.

It is essentially an argument between the brain and the intestines, with neither side wanting to give in.

Many people notice this connection in daily life without realising it.

Some lose their appetite when anxious.

Others stress-eat an entire packet of chips while promising themselves it is “just one bad day”.

Some experience bloating, stomach discomfort or diarrhoea during emotionally difficult periods.

The gut is not simply digesting food; it is processing your emotions.

Beyond diet

Sleep also matters.

Studies suggest that poor sleep patterns can disrupt the microbiome, while exercise appears to improve bacterial diversity.

Even spending time outdoors and reducing stress may positively influence gut health.

Your microbes are surprisingly sensitive little creatures.

Of course, it is important not to oversimplify things.

Depression, anxiety and mental health disorders are complex conditions involving genetics, environment, psychology and biology.

Gut bacteria are only one piece of a much larger puzzle.

Eating yoghurt alone will not solve emotional distress, and probiotics are not magical happiness pills.

However, maintaining a healthy gut may be one useful way to support overall well-being, alongside proper medical care, healthy lifestyle habits and emotional support.
